通过vi服务器运行vi,动态改变界面改变VI的属性KCC.ppt

文档介绍:

动态改变界面*VI服务器改变控件的属性改变VI的属性动态改变界面加深理解对象引用VI的引用VI作为LabVIEW应用程序的基本单元,具有丰富的属性和方法。VI的引用相当于C语言的函数指针,通过VI的引用,可以实现动态改变VI的属性。VI引用,不仅可以改变所在VI的属性,也可以改变其他VI的属性。动态改变界面获取VI引用的方式(1)通过应用程序选板中“属性节点”函数,右键“选择类”(2)通过应用程序选板中“VI服务器引用”函数,可以选择应用程序引用,当前VI引用和窗格引用。(3)更为通用的方法,利用应用程序选板中“打开VI引用”函数,该函数不但可以获取本VI的引用,也可以获得其他VI的属性。动态改变界面改变所在VI的属性Demo:修改所在VI标题(设置所在VI属性.vi)如需设置本VI的属性,将通用“属性节点”关联的类选择为VI(默认设置为应用程序)。通过通用属性节点右键菜单可以显示所有其他类别对象的属性。在没有任何引用输入时,这个属性节点的属性设置是针对所在VI的。动态改变界面改变其他VI的属性如需设置其他VI的属性,就要给属性节点传入一个VI的引用。VI的引用可以通过静态和动态两种方法得到。所谓静态:编写程序时,就已经指定好了这个引用所指向的VI;静态方法:使用“编程——应用程序控制——静态VI引用”节点。Demo:修改其他VI标题(设置其他VI属性(静态引用).vi)动态改变界面改变其他VI的属性所谓动态:程序在运行中,才知道需要设置哪个VI;动态方法:使用“编程——应用程序控制——打开VI引用”节点。把VI的路径传给函数,返回这个VI的引用Demo:修改其他VI标题(设置其他VI属性(动态引用).vi)动态改变界面小结和作业小结:VI是常用的LabVIEW对象,通过VI的引用,可以实现动态改变VI的属性。VI的引用可以通过静态(程序编写时指定)和动态(程序运行时设置)两种方法得到。作业:(1)将”设置所在VI属性.vi”中通过“通用属性节点-选择类”的方式设置VI标题,改为通过“VI服务器引用-链接属性节点”的方式设置VI标题;(2)创建VI,显示当前VI的“VI统计”属性,已查看所占内存空间,在前面板上显示“程序框图字节量”、“代码字节量”和“前面板字节量”。动态改变界面谢谢观看!

内容来自淘豆网www.taodocs.com转载请标明出处.

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值